The release of Captain Marvel in 2019 was a groundbreaking moment for the Marvel Cinematic Universe. Not only did it introduce the first female-led superhero film in the franchise, but it also brought to light the complexities of Carol Danvers, the film's protagonist. One of the most intriguing aspects of her character is her sexuality, and recently, the film's director, Anna Boden, spoke out about Carol Danvers' sexual orientation.

In an interview with Variety, Boden addressed the topic of Danvers' sexuality, stating that the character's romantic interests were not a focus of the film. "We wanted to tell a story about a woman who is figuring out who she is and her own powers," Boden said. "Her romantic interests were not the driving force behind the film."

The Complexity of Carol Danvers

Carol Danvers, also known as Captain Marvel, is a complex and multi-faceted character in the Marvel Universe. In the comics, she has had various romantic relationships with both men and women, showcasing the fluidity of her sexuality. However, the film adaptation of Captain Marvel chose to focus on her journey of self-discovery and empowerment, rather than her romantic entanglements.

The decision to steer clear of exploring Danvers' sexuality in the film was met with mixed reactions from fans. Some argued that it was a missed opportunity to showcase LGBTQ+ representation in the superhero genre, while others appreciated the focus on Danvers' personal growth and development as a superhero.
